| Award title | Pivots: Immersive Experiential Training for Robotic Additive Manufacturing in Construction |
|---|---|
| Award ID | 2526098 |
| Awardee | University of Illinois at Urbana-Champaign |
| City | URBANA |
| State | IL |
| Amount obligated | $1,000,000 |
| Principal investigator | Houtan Jebelli |
| Program | ExLENT |
| Start date | 10/01/2025 |
| Abstract | This project aims to serve the national interest by developing a skilled workforce capable of deploying robotic additive manufacturing in the construction industry—an emerging technology that is critical for increasing productivity and addressing persistent labor shortages in infrastructure development.
